Vanity Fair Women’s Enchanted Lace Full Figure Underwire #75-031 Research indicates that over 70% of women don’t wear the correct size bra. A well-fitted bra should feel comfortable and complement your natural shape. Once you determine the correct size for you, Vanity Fair can help you find the perfect bra in just the right fabric and color. Confidence comes from within, and it’s easier to feel confident when you know you’re wearing a bra that fits and flatters your shape. These simple guidelines below will help you select the size that works best.

Band Measurement
Using a measuring tape, take a snug measurement around the rib cage, directly under the bust. If the measurement is an odd number, add 5 inches to determine band size. If the measurement is even, add 6 inches.

Tip: When measuring for band size, place your index finger under the tape measure to allow for body expansion necessary for sitting.

Cup Measurement Using a measuring tape, measure around the fullest part of the bust (do not stretch tape tightly). Then, take the difference between this measurement and the band size measurement to determine the cup size.

If the difference is:

  • 1 inch … you are a cup size A
  • 2 inches … you are a cup size B
  • 3 inches … you are a cup size C
  • 4 inches … you are a cup size D
  • 5 inches … you are a cup size DD
  • 6 inches … you are a cup size DDD

Tip: If the band seems too tight, increase one band size and decrease one cup size. If the band seems too large and rides up in the back, decrease one band size and increase one cup size.

Note: The measurement is just a starting point. Different styles fit differently, and each style must be tried on to assure a proper fit. It is best to measure while wearing an underwire bra.

Playtex Expectant Moments Underwire Alternative Bra Style # 4426

September 27, 2008 by bras  
Filed under Playtex

Playtex Expectant Moments Underwire Alternative Bra Style # 4426 Playtex Expectant Moments Underwire Alternative Bra Style # 4426 The underwire alternative perfect for support with comfort. Soft 2-ply cotton-blend cups and flexible undercup fabric braiding provide shaping, support and absorbency. Convenient cup attachment allows for easy one-handed nursing access. With multiple back settings for a custom fit as your body changes. While you’re expecting, the roomy cups allow for changing breast size. Once baby arrives, cups easily accommodate breast pads. Special Playtex clasp gives you convenient one-hand access for no-fuss nursing. Undercup braiding helps shape and support you gently. Soft, absorbent fabric feels soothing…for both you and baby. Fiber Content: Center, cup, frame: 55% Polyester, 45% Cotton. Cup lining, frame lining: 100% Polyester. Bock: 85% Cotton, 15% Spandex. Center lining: 100% Nylon. Exclusive of other trim and elastics.
